PGST WiFi Home Alarm System with Sensors & App Control
- ✓ No monthly fees
- ✓ Easy 10-minute install
- ✓ Multiple operation options
- ✕ No 5G support
- ✕ Limited to 99 sensors
| Connectivity | GSM/4G LTE and Wi-Fi dual connection |
| Alarm Sound Level | 120dB siren |
| Display | 2.4-inch LCD screen |
| Sensor Capacity | Supports up to 99 sensors |
| Installation Time | Approximately 10 minutes wireless setup |
| Control Methods | Keypad, Mobile App, Remote Control, RFID Card |
Jumping right into the PGST WiFi Home Alarm System, what immediately catches my eye is how sleek and compact the control unit feels. It’s surprisingly lightweight, yet it packs a punch with its all-in-one design — combining the keypad, siren, and base station into one neat device.
The LCD screen is refreshingly clear, providing instant updates on the alarm status and sensor activity. It’s intuitive enough that even my elderly parents could navigate it without fuss.
Setting it up was a breeze — I had the entire system up and running within 10 minutes, thanks to the pre-installed double-sided stickers for sensors and no wiring needed.
What I really like is how flexible the operation methods are. You can arm or disarm the system via the app, remote control, RFID card, or even the physical keypad.
Plus, connecting it to Alexa was smooth — voice commands work flawlessly, adding another layer of convenience.
Security-wise, the 120dB siren is loud enough to scare off intruders and alert neighbors. The remote notifications via SMS, app alerts, or calls mean I’m always in the loop, whether I’m home or away.
The silent alarm mode is a thoughtful touch, letting me get alerts without disturbing the peace.
Expandability is a big plus — supporting up to 99 sensors means I can easily add more door or motion sensors later. It feels like a genuinely smart and customizable setup, perfect for Malaysian homes looking for reliable, no-monthly-fee security.
KERUI Standalone Home Office Shop Security Alarm System
- ✓ Easy DIY installation
- ✓ Loud 115dB siren
- ✓ Expandable up to 30 detectors
- ✕ Must trigger sensors quickly
- ✕ Setup guide could be clearer
| Siren Volume | Up to 115dB |
| Sensor Compatibility | Supports up to 30 wireless detectors |
| Remote Control Range | Typically up to 30 meters (inferred from standard remote control ranges) |
| Alarm System Power Source | Battery-powered main unit (specific battery type not specified) |
| Expandable Compatibility | Compatible with KERUI brand alarm hubs |
| Alarm Trigger Time | Sensors must be triggered within 6 seconds during operation |
Compared to the old alarm systems I’ve fiddled with, this KERUI standalone setup feels like a breath of fresh air—mainly because of how straightforward it is to customize and expand. The new siren host from August 2020 is noticeably more responsive, but I’ll admit, you need to trigger the sensors within six seconds or reconnect them to reset the setup.
That took a bit of getting used to, but once I got the hang of it, it was smooth sailing.
The included remote controls make arming and disarming super simple, especially when I need to secure the house quickly. The loud alarm—up to 115dB—is seriously deafening, enough to wake the neighbors if needed.
Setting up the sensors, which support up to 30 wireless detectors, was surprisingly easy, thanks to the manual and video tutorials. I especially liked the door alarm’s remote security code feature—no more fiddling around with complicated panels.
What really stood out is the SOS button on the remote. Pressing it triggers the siren, which is perfect for emergencies involving kids or seniors.
I tested it a few times, and it really does get neighbors’ attention fast. Plus, the system’s compatibility with other KERUI hubs means you can customize it further if you like DIY projects.
The only thing I found a bit tricky was remembering to trigger sensors within six seconds, but overall, it’s a reliable, expandable, and affordable solution for home security in Malaysia.
Clouree WiFi Wireless Alarm System for Home Security, GSM
- ✓ Easy DIY installation
- ✓ Dual network connectivity
- ✓ Multiple alert options
- ✕ WiFi only supports 2.4GHz
- ✕ Limited app compatibility
| Network Compatibility | Supports dual network modes: WiFi (2.4GHz) and GSM/3G/4G |
| Alarm Modes | Supports multi-channel alarm modes including app push, SMS push, and voice monitoring |
| Remote Control Compatibility | Compatible with ‘Tuya’ and ‘Smart Life’ app for remote control and parameter setting |
| Installation Method | DIY installation with included screws and adhesive tape, no professional setup required |
| Sensor Types | Includes wireless infrared motion detectors and door sensors |
| Preset Phone and SMS Numbers | Supports 5 groups of preset phone numbers and SMS contacts with customizable on/off settings |
The moment I unboxed the Clouree WiFi Wireless Alarm System, I was struck by how compact and sleek it looks. Its matte white finish and minimalist design make it blend seamlessly into most home interiors.
Handling the main control panel, I noticed it’s lightweight but feels sturdy, with a smooth touch screen that’s surprisingly responsive.
Setting it up was a breeze—no fuss at all. Each sensor and detector came with its own screws and adhesive tape, so I just stuck them around my doors and windows in minutes.
The instructions were clear, and I appreciated that I didn’t need any special tools or professional help. The system’s dual network mode impressed me; I could connect via WiFi or GSM, which gives peace of mind if one network drops.
Using the app was straightforward. I could arm and disarm the system remotely, and the push notifications worked instantly when I tested the sensors.
The voice monitoring feature felt secure—getting a call or SMS instantly if something triggered the alarm was a game-changer. The multi-channel alerts, including app push, SMS, and voice, make sure you don’t miss a thing.
What I liked most was how customizable it is. You can preset different phone numbers for alerts, and the remote control option means I can turn it on or off without opening the app.
The infrared motion detector responded quickly to movement, giving me confidence it’s reliable. Overall, it’s a smart, simple, and effective security solution for home protection.

How Can You Choose the Right Alarm System for Your Home in Malaysia?
To choose the right alarm system for your home in Malaysia, consider factors such as your home’s layout, the types of security features you need, your budget, and the reliability of the service providers.
-
Home Layout: Assess the size and design of your home. Larger homes may require multiple sensors and cameras. A study by Rahman et al. (2021) emphasizes that home layout influences the effectiveness of surveillance systems.
-
Security Features: Identify which features are essential for your home. Common options include:
– Motion sensors: Detect movement in and around your home.
– Door and window sensors: Alert you when doors or windows are opened unexpectedly.
– Cameras: Provide visual monitoring, either live or recorded.
– Smart home integration: Allows you to control your alarm system remotely through a smartphone app. -
Budget: Determine how much you are willing to spend. Alarm systems can range from basic models costing around RM500 to advanced systems exceeding RM3,000. A report by the Malaysian Security Industry Association (2022) highlights that investing in a quality alarm system can reduce burglary risks.
-
Service Provider Reliability: Research potential service providers for their reputation and customer service. Look for reviews or testimonials. Ensure they offer support and maintenance options. The Better Business Bureau recommends checking service providers’ ratings before making a decision.
-
Installation Options: Decide between professional installation or DIY. Many systems offer both options. Professional installation may provide better reliability and assurance, while DIY can save costs.
-
Monitoring Options: Choose between self-monitoring and professional monitoring services. Self-monitoring allows you to receive alerts on your devices. Professional monitoring provides 24/7 monitoring by a service team, enhancing security.
-
Warranty and Support: Check for warranties on the alarm system. Look for providers that offer responsive customer support to assist with any issues or upgrades in the future. A comprehensive warranty can add value to your investment.
Considering these factors will help ensure that you select a suitable alarm system that meets your home security needs in Malaysia.
